如何描述R中数据帧的数据结构?

时间:2016-08-08 10:28:05

标签: r

我正在寻找一种描述R中数据帧的数据结构(而不​​是数据本身)的方法。

df = read.csv2('data.csv')
desc(df)

输出应该像

 df.columnname1
 df.columnname2 (type)
 ...

1 个答案:

答案 0 :(得分:0)

尝试:

df_types <- data.frame("col_types" = unlist(lapply(df, typeof)))

我使用lapply循环获取其类型的列。此输出是一个命名列表,因此我使用unlist转换为命名的字符向量并将其转换为data.frame以获得您之后的格式的打印输出。 / p>